[ ] Verify the Skylark flag-rollout framework has all staged flags set to their launch percentages before the window opens. On-call: confirm the kill-switch for each new flag responds within the Dunmore dashboard, and that stale flags from the prior cycle were archived. Any anomaly goes into the rollout log, keyed to the framework build token that follows.

pipeline stamp: htk9_ce63042d9

// MAX_QUEUE_DRAIN_MS governs the cutover window while we replace
// the homegrown Fettler job queue with Straddleworks. During the
// migration, both queues run in parallel; this constant bounds how
// long Fettler may drain before we force-fail remaining jobs and
// replay them. Raised from 5s after the Harwick staging test.
// The migration build's trace token is noted below.

session token of tajef-bageg = htk21_5d90d574934f3ccae6437

## Introduce per-tenant rate quotas in the Orvane gateway

For the release manager: this change replaces our global throttle with per-tenant quotas, resolved at request time from the tenant registry and cached for sixty seconds. Tenants without an explicit quota inherit the tier default; overage returns a retryable status with a hint header. Rollout is gated behind a flag, defaulting off, and the old throttle remains as a backstop until two clean release cycles pass.

The initial tier defaults we intend to ship are listed below.

limits module of taguf-hafog:
WEIGHTS = {
    "wenox": 690,
    "wenok": 782,
    "kelax": 41,
    "holox": 338,
    "quenir": 39,
}